From the Academic Session 2004-2005, Indian Institutes of Technology have started
conducting a Joint Admission Test to M.Sc. (JAM) for admission to M.Sc. and other post-B.Sc. programmes at the IITs. The Joint
Admission Test to M.Sc.2007 (JAM 2007) may be held on March-April, 2007 (Sunday) for admission to industrial mathematics
and informatics.The Test is open to Indian Nationals, irrespective of caste, creed and gender. There is no age restriction
